David Archuleta took to Twitter to let everyone know how he felt about Walt Disney Pictures “Alice In Wonderland” movie directed by Tim Burton.
“Just finished watching Alice in Wonderland. Very interesting haha. But I thought the moral of the story at the end was inspiring.”
